Cognitive processing therapy cpt is a cognitivebehavioral treatment for posttraumatic stress disorder ptsd and related problems.

Veteranmilitary version part 1 introduction to cognitive processing therapy cognitive processing therapy cpt is a 12session therapy that has been found effective for both ptsd and other corollary symptoms following traumatic events monson et al, 2006. This newly updated fifth edition presents a comprehensive overview of the key approaches to individual therapy practice, including three new chapters on narrative therapy, solutionfocused therapy and integrative and eclectic approaches. Each chapter uses a standard format which offers the reader a clear pathway through the key issues, and the work is brought alive with indepth case studies.
